Facile synthesis of o- and p-(1-trifluoromethyl)-alkylated phenols via generation and reaction of quinone methides
Gong, Yuefa,Kato, Katsuya
, p. 431 - 434 (2002)
Several ortho- and para-(1-chloro-2,2,2-trifluoroethyl) phenols were prepared from the corresponding alcohols and thionyl chloride in the presence of pyridine. They reacted smoothly with sodium borohydride and Grignard reagents under mild conditions, forming 2,2,2-trifluoroethyl- or 1-trifluoromethylalkylphenols in high yields.
BETA-SECRETASE MODULATORS AND METHODS OF USE
-
Page/Page column 169, (2010/11/27)
The present invention comprises a new class of compounds useful for the modulation of Beta-secretase enzyme activity and for the treatment of Beta-secretase mediated diseases, including Alzheimer's disease (AD) and related conditions. In one embodiment, the compounds have a general Formula (I); wherein A, B, W, R3, R4, R5, i and j are defined herein. The invention also comprises pharmaceutical compositions including one or more compounds of Formula (I), methods of use for these compounds, including treatment of AD and related diseases, by administering the compound(s) of Formula (I), or compositions including them, to a subject. The invention also comprises further embodiments of Formulas (II) and (III), intermediates and processes useful for the preparation of compounds of the invention.
